Transaction 74ab21766fa31bdac87e5e9758e98ff1262008b2626c5b78988adc96b1533829
1 Input
1 Output
-
74ab21766fa31bdac87e5e9758e98ff1262008b2626c5b78988adc96b1533829:0
- value
- 4149644
- script pubkey
- OP_0 OP_PUSHBYTES_20 66cbb939fed0009169eccbb664620246bf8703ec
- address
- bc1qvm9mjw076qqfz60vewmxgcszg6lcwqlvuk9sky